It showed Mikasa and her husband (hinted to be Jean) and child visiting Eren, Mikasa visiting him one last time before dying (still wearing the scarf), decades and centuries go by as Paradis becomes advanced, a helicopter crashing into a building, rocket launchers placed by Eren's grave fighting against enemy planes bombing them, then nukes blowing everything up, then centuries going by leading into the post credit scene.
